Vienna Police Crime Report 10/27/07:
Location: Cedar Lane Shopping center, 200 block Cedar Ln., S.E.
Details: Malicious wounding on 10/27/07 - A man reported being approached outside the shopping center by two men, one of whom cut his hand with a knife. The victim fled to a nearby business from where the police were called. The suspect with the knife is described as a hispanic male, 5'10" tall, 170 lbs., medium length hair, no facial hair. The other suspect is described as a hispanic male, wearing blue jeans and a blue shirt.
